Study On Information Continuity Evaluation Model Of Expressway Guidance System In Surrounding Areas Of Yinchuan City

Road guidance sign is a necessary component of traffic guidance system.Continuous path guidance information can guide the driver to choose the right travel path,reduce detours,and improve travel efficiency.Therefore,analyzing the information continuity of road guidance sign and evaluating whether its guidance function meets the needs of users become an important factor to measure the information quality of road guidance sign system.There are many researches on the information continuity of urban road network,but few on expressway network.The existing research does not consider the influence of the frequency of information items and the difference of main radiation directions on the continuity.Based on the above research significance and status,this paper mainly studies from the following aspects:(1)This thesis analyzes the composition of Yinchuan Expressway guide sign system,studies its composition and existing information item selection rules from the types of entrance guide sign,main line location direction,location distance sign and exit guide sign,classifies the information items,and studies the information item characteristics of Yinchuan Expressway guide sign and the habit of spatial positioning of citizens according to the investigation and it reflects the local differences.(2)Based on the investigation and analysis of the spatial positioning habits of citizens when driving,this thesis sums up the problems of the current situation of Yinchuan Expressway travelers’ use of the guidance system,and finds the existing problems in the information selection of the expressway guidance system around Yinchuan,especially the problem of information continuity.(3)From the point of view of node,path,region,frequency information item and system,the continuity of guidance information is defined,that is to say,the continuity of information in Expressway guidance system is analyzed from three levels of micro,meso and macro respectively,and the necessity of analyzing the continuity from macro perspective is pointed out.(4)This thesis studies the quantitative analysis and evaluation model of information continuity of Expressway guidance system.Taking the regional road network guidance system as the research object,this thesis puts forward the quantitative analysis and evaluation index and calculation method of the information continuity of the guidance system from the macro,meso and micro levels.(5)This thesis studies and puts forward the steps of the continuity evaluation of the guidance system: using information item statistics and its frequency algorithm to count the information item and its frequency in the guidance system,combining with k-means The algorithm divides the information items into three types: high,medium and low frequency information items;selects one of the information items,uses the guide sign information table and the directed road section information table,according to the conditions that the effective path should meet,uses the python effective path search algorithm to determine the effective path set containing this information;then uses the calculation method of the information continuity evaluation index of the guide system to calculate the node,path and region continuity,then calculate the continuity evaluation index of frequency information item and system continuity evaluation index,and evaluate the information continuity of the whole region guide system.
